#cf859c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f859c is composed of 81.2% red, 52.2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 24.6%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 341.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 66.7%. #cf859c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9f0b39.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#cf859c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f859c has RGB values of R:207, G:133,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.25,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13600156.

Shades and Tints of #cf859c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f7 is the lightest one.
